I run a Zodiac Gold + Voltikus off a mach2music server running puremusic. Beware that the Zodiac needs at least 300(!!) hours of break-in before getting to its reference quality sound. It'll be miserably coarse and constricted straight out of the box but boy is it great once it settles in! As to support, the usb2.0 implementation is one of the attractions of the Zodiac Gold: I am using the spdif on a wadia 170i with Neutron clock conversion but the Mac is far superior
